Output 669ca26b99b2875e547a5153e397be6748616163d8d4b1f1e9ca1fdc24e6372b:0

value
204069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b205ece64abe1982c66756eb55957121a3fec4c OP_EQUAL
address
375eZzVwuGMdbpuYAwq8TpKwdNufmx2maP
transaction
669ca26b99b2875e547a5153e397be6748616163d8d4b1f1e9ca1fdc24e6372b
confirmations
138151
spent
true